commit | 7dc58e2c32b3dd7c494eb910939ce4d5877ab496 | [log] [tgz] |
---|---|---|
author | Sven Selberg <svense@axis.com> | Fri Apr 29 13:12:16 2022 +0200 |
committer | Sven Selberg <sven.selberg@axis.com> | Mon May 02 12:56:19 2022 +0000 |
tree | 6dfa96ed6797fdee9b573477dc08feadfea6e6af | |
parent | 5c808ff99ed8c701dad23cf4fbfc45217e05ee38 [diff] |
LoggingContext: Consider empty aclLogRecords as emtpy Bug: Issue 15889 Release-Notes: Fix "Logging context is not empty" log spam. Change-Id: Id34aa123a771466196049635c5ee13c9def19063
diff --git a/java/com/google/gerrit/server/logging/LoggingContext.java b/java/com/google/gerrit/server/logging/LoggingContext.java index 5611d08..740058c 100644 --- a/java/com/google/gerrit/server/logging/LoggingContext.java +++ b/java/com/google/gerrit/server/logging/LoggingContext.java
@@ -91,7 +91,7 @@ && forceLogging.get() == null && performanceLogging.get() == null && aclLogging.get() == null - && aclLogRecords.get() == null; + && (aclLogRecords.get() == null || aclLogRecords.get().isEmpty()); } public void clear() {
diff --git a/java/com/google/gerrit/server/logging/MutableAclLogRecords.java b/java/com/google/gerrit/server/logging/MutableAclLogRecords.java index baa9b1f..a692d2b 100644 --- a/java/com/google/gerrit/server/logging/MutableAclLogRecords.java +++ b/java/com/google/gerrit/server/logging/MutableAclLogRecords.java
@@ -45,6 +45,10 @@ return ImmutableList.copyOf(aclLogRecords); } + public boolean isEmpty() { + return aclLogRecords.isEmpty(); + } + @Override public String toString() { return MoreObjects.toStringHelper(this).add("aclLogRecords", aclLogRecords).toString();